Three Times Longer

I was in Petsmart today picking up Greenies for the crew when I saw a cute Loofa style toy that said it would last three times longer than other Loofa style toys. Since I had a coupon I thought I would try it out. The last Loofa style toy I bought for Alex lasted about fifteen minutes so anything that lasts more than that is not a bad buy in my book. Well, its about nine hours later and that thing is still, more or less, intact.


Here's the link to the product at Petsmart. I got the one that looks like a cow.


Here's what it looks like now:



The head is empty of stuffing, so is the butt and the legs. The ears, horns and tail are gone. The rough stuff on the outside of the body and the little black heart shaped spots that made this such a cute toy are scattered all over the house.


This toy gets a qualified thumbs up. It has lasted but I had to disembowel it a lttle while ago to remove the squeaker thing before Alex could find it. I did put all the stuffing back, and then some, so he should stay amused for a couple of more hours tomorrow.


I just wish these doggie toys were more durable without sqeakers!
